Are bialys from Bialystok?
Bialys (short for the Yiddish bialystok kuchen) originated in Bialystok, Poland, and were brought to America by Eastern European Jews immigrating in the early 1900s. Also unlike bagels, which are boiled before they are baked, bialys are not boiled.

What is in the middle of a bialy?
A bialy is round with a depressed middle that is filled with cooked onion and sometimes poppy seeds. Unlike bagels, which are boiled and then baked, a bialy is simply baked. This gives it a matte, rather than shiny, outside, and it doesn’t have a pull-away crust. The inside has large, puffy bubbles.

Is a bialy healthier than a bagel?
According to the country’s leader purveyor of bagels, Dunkin’ Donuts, a Pepper Jack Supreme Bagel can clock in at over 400 calories and a plain at 310, compared to a bialy’s more modest 170 calories. In the end, while tradition is nice and necessary, market forces even affect the humble bialy.

Should you toast a bialy?
And unlike the bagel, which loses a reason to live after a few hours, the bialy is practically designed for toasting. It’s good plain the next day, and even better when toasted and buttered.
How do you heat up a bialy?
Bialys may be reheated, wrapped in foil, in a 350-degree oven for 10 minutes. Exchanges per serving: 2½ starch.
